Location, Overview

Pullman is a vibrant college town in Whitman County, located in southeastern Washington near the Idaho border. It’s home to Washington State University (WSU), making it a center of education, research, and innovation.

Community, Lifestyle

Life in Pullman revolves around university events, sports, and local traditions. Residents enjoy strong community bonds, walkable neighborhoods, and scenic rolling hills that define the Palouse region. Cultural activities, art exhibits, and Cougar football games add excitement year-round.
